January 20, 2025 Monday Winter Weather
Arctic blast to combine with Gulf of Mexico moisture for historic snowfall
January 2025 was the 33rd-coolest January in the 132-year national record (1895–2026), at 29.2°F against a 1991–2020 normal of 32.3°F (-3.2°F).
January 2025 was the 5th-driest January in the 132-year national record (1895–2026), at 1.4in against a 1991–2020 normal of 2.3in (-1.0in).
NOAA/NCEI Climate at a Glance, contiguous United States. This is the observed record for the month, not a score of anything said in this piece — the forecast ledger begins 2026-08-17 and cannot reach earlier posts.
The Lower 48 is in the grips of a major Arctic blast — lobe of the tropospheric circumpolar vortex — with coldest air east of the Rockies.
Lower 48 average temperature at 6:30 PM ET was only 18.2°F with 213 million below freezing and 15 million subzero.
